Significant differences between kielbasa and pomegranate

  • Kielbasa has more iron, vitamin C, monounsaturated fat, and polyunsaturated fat; however, pomegranate is richer in fiber.
  • Kielbasa covers your daily sodium needs 52% more than pomegranate.

Specific food types used in this comparison are Kielbasa, Polish, turkey and beef, smoked and Pomegranates, raw.

Comparison summary

Which food is lower in Cholesterol?
Pomegranate
Pomegranate is lower in Cholesterol (difference - 70mg)
Which food contains less Sodium?
Pomegranate
Pomegranate contains less Sodium (difference - 1197mg)
Which food is lower in Saturated fat?
Pomegranate
Pomegranate is lower in Saturated fat (difference - 6.11g)
Which food is cheaper?
Pomegranate
Pomegranate is cheaper (difference - $0.5)
Which food is richer in minerals?
Pomegranate
Pomegranate is relatively richer in minerals
Which food is richer in vitamins?
Pomegranate
Pomegranate is relatively richer in vitamins
Which food is lower in Sugar?
Kielbasa
Kielbasa is lower in Sugar (difference - 13.67g)
Which food is lower in glycemic index?
Kielbasa
Kielbasa is lower in glycemic index (difference - 28)
